在数字货币和区块链的世界中,隐私和安全性是两大亘古不变的主题。随着越来越多的人们关注他们的在线隐私,环签名作为一种创新的技术受到越来越多的重视。本文将深度探讨环签名的原理、应用以及它为用户提供的隐私保障。 环签名的基本概念 环签名(Ring Signature)是一种加密签名技术,它允许一组用户对一条消息进行签名,而不透露具体是哪个用户进行的签名。换句话说,签名者的身份被隐藏在一个“环”中,这个环包含多个用户的公钥。这使得即便在公开区块链上,交易的发起者也不会被轻易识别。
环签名的工作原理 环签名的工作原理可以通过以下步骤来理解: 1. **选择公钥**:在开始签名之前,参与者会选择一个包含多名用户公钥的集合。 2. **生成签名**:当某一位用户希望发起一条交易时,他使用自己的私钥生成一个签名,然而这个签名并不是单独生成的,而是与选定环中的其他用户的公钥一起生成的。 3. **验证签名**:接收者在收到消息和签名后,可以使用环内任意一个用户的公钥来验证这个签名的有效性,但无法确定具体是哪位用户进行了签名。 环签名的优点 随着隐私保护需求的增加,环签名技术展现出了诸多优点: 1. **增强匿名性**:环签名使得用户的身份不易被追踪,同时确保交易的合法性。它在用户交易的私密性和透明度之间取得了平衡。 2. **抵抗身份伪造**:因为签名是由多者生成的,独立的第三方很难伪造用户身份,也无法确认哪个用户签署了某一条信息。
3. **应用广泛**:环签名不仅适用于数字货币,许多需要保护用户隐私的应用场景(如在线投票、匿名捐赠等)也可以受益于此技术。 环签名的应用场景 环签名在不同领域的应用逐渐增多,以下是几个主要的应用场景: 1. **加密货币**:环签名被广泛应用于隐私币(如门罗币、Zcash)中,以保护用户的交易隐私。在这些币种中,环签名帮助隐藏发送者和接收者的地址,提高了交易的匿名性。 2. **投票系统**:在电子投票中使用环签名可以有效防止选票被追踪,从而保障投票者的隐私,提升投票系统的公正性。 3. **内容发布**:在一些需要匿名的论坛或平台中,用户可以利用环签名来保护自己的身份,使得他们可以自由发表意见而不用担心受到打压。 环签名与其他隐私技术的比较 虽然环签名技术在隐私保护方面展现出独特的优势,但它并不是唯一的选择。
与其他隐私保护技术(如零知识证明、盲签名)相比,环签名有其优缺点: 1. **零知识证明**:与环签名不同,零知识证明允许某一方(证明者)向另一方(验证者)证明自己知道某个秘密,而无需透露该秘密。虽然零知识证明在安全性方面非常出色,但实现上常常比环签名复杂。 2. **盲签名**:盲签名技术允许用户在签名前对消息进行“盲化”,使得签名者无法看见签署的内容。这种方法适用于某些特定的应用场景,但难以在更广泛的范围内建立用户信任。 环签名的未来 随着区块链技术的发展,环签名及其应用场景也在不断演进。许多开发者和研究人员正在探索如何进一步提升环签名的效率和安全性。
未来,我们可能会看到更多结合环签名与其他隐私保护技术的新解决方案,造福用户。 结语 环签名作为一种创新的隐私保护技术,正在为数字世界中的交易和互动提供更高的安全性和匿名性。随着人们对隐私保护重视程度的提高,环签名的应用将愈加广泛。无论是在加密货币、在线投票,还是其他需要匿名的场景中,环签名都将发挥越来越重要的作用。通过理解和利用这一技术,用户可以更好地保护自己的隐私,享受在线活动的自由与安全。